Output 3eb564871a82fc624ffab830ed8745583c9028a3ff2f13fed2ea61ff04d08b54:25

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dac96c767c40c40177353d97a23c8a2a441398be4cd30a677677a5de87e2e05a
address
bc1pmtykcanugrzqzae48kt6y0y29fzp8x97fnfs5emkw7jaaplzupdq9r8n0z
transaction
3eb564871a82fc624ffab830ed8745583c9028a3ff2f13fed2ea61ff04d08b54